He had just heated up his dinner and was about to sit to eat when the lights went out.
'It must be a power failure.' He thought to himself, as he recalled Ravi telling him that due to excessive load shedding they had to face a lot of trouble at the hospital.
He took out a couple of candles from the drawer and lighted them. He hadn't imagined of having a candle light dinner all by himself here in this bunglow, as he sat down to eat his dinner.
He had just made the bed and was about to get into it, when he heard the sound.
A faint knocking sound on his front door.
He strained his ears thinking if he had heard right.
Knock.... Knock.
There it went again. This time it was louder and clearer.
He went towards the hall and opened the door.
